The hockey team will play its first important game this afternoon, with Brown at Providence. Neither team has had much practice for the past three weeks, so that it is impossible to forecast the probable result. The Harvard team will play in the following order: Forwards-Rumsey, Goodridge, Winsor, Laverack; cover-point, Penhallow; point, Hardy, (Barrows); goal, Manning, (Barrows).
There were so few men at the rink yesterday afternoon that no regular practice was held; the time was given to improving the team work of the forwards and the defence of the backs.
